Hi,

the upgrade of iceweasel from 31.x to 38.x broke conkeror in Jessie:
https://bugs.debian.org/795597

I've prepared an update cherry-picking an upstream fix which is
already part of conkeror in testing and unstable:

+Origin: commit 6906955ef78caeb357b729e1f608dfe1f0171dcc
+Author: Jeremy Maitin-Shepard <jer...@jeremyms.com>
+Date:   Thu Feb 26 19:10:05 2015 -0800
+Description: application.js: fix matching of module load error messages to 
work with Firefox 36
+ Firefox 36 includes the path in some error messages, causing them to
+ no longer precisely match the strings that had been specified.  Using
+ String.prototype.startsWith fixes the problem.
+
+diff --git a/components/application.js b/components/application.js
+index 962ca73..bd9f30c 100644
+--- a/components/application.js
++++ b/components/application.js
+@@ -161,10 +161,9 @@ application.prototype = {
+                         return;
+                     }
+                 } catch (e if (typeof e == 'string' &&
+-                               {"ContentLength not available (not a local 
URL?)":true,
+-                                "Error creating channel (invalid URL 
scheme?)":true,
+-                                "Error opening input stream (invalid 
filename?)":true}
+-                               [e])) {
++                               (e.startsWith("ContentLength not available 
(not a local URL?)") ||
++                                e.startsWith("Error creating channel (invalid 
URL scheme?)") ||
++                                e.startsWith("Error opening input stream 
(invalid filename?)")))) {
+                     // null op. (suppress error, try next path)
+                 }
+                 if (autoext)
